Description & Estimates







Public records show 502, Reading Road, Wokingham to be an early-century freehold house with 2,249 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 409 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 5 bedrooms with a garden.
502, Reading Road, Wokingham has an estimated sale value of £691,225 and an estimated rental value of £2,890 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.

Energy Efficiency
502, Reading Road, Woking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 22 Nov 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
502, Reading Road, Wokingham last changed hands on 13th July 2020, selling for £580,000. The transaction was logged as a freehold house by HM Land Registry.
That is its only recorded sale since 1995.
The market for similar properties has risen by 29.2% since July 2020.
